The Stakes

The consequences of being accused or convicted of a sex crime in Pennsylvania are severe and far-reaching:

  • Legal Penalties: Convictions can lead to long prison sentences, hefty fines, and mandatory registration as a sex offender. The severity often depends on the specific crime, the presence of aggravating factors, and the accused's criminal history.
  • Personal and Social Impact: The stigma associated with sex crime allegations can devastate personal relationships, professional standing, and overall reputation. Accused individuals often face isolation, shame, and significant psychological stress.
  • Future Ramifications: Beyond the immediate legal consequences, a conviction can have lasting effects on employment opportunities, housing, and basic civil rights. The requirement to register as a sex offender can further perpetuate these challenges.

Defense Strategies for Sex Crimes

Investigation and Evidence Gathering

A thorough investigation is the cornerstone of any effective defense strategy. This includes gathering all available exculpatory evidence, such as text messages, emails, or witness statements that can support the accused's version of events. In many cases, there may also be physical evidence that can be re-examined or retested using independent experts to challenge the prosecution's claims.

Challenging the Prosecution's Case

Challenging the prosecution's case involves a meticulous review of all the evidence they present, questioning its validity, the methods used to obtain it, and the interpretation of the findings. Attorney Lesniak focuses on identifying any weaknesses or inconsistencies in the prosecution's case and leverages these to build a strong defense.

Consent and Other Defenses

In sex crime cases, consent is often a central issue. Proving that the alleged victim consented to the act can be a powerful defense. Other potential strategies include mistaken identity, where the accused was not the individual who committed the alleged act, or alibi, where the accused was not at the location at the time of the alleged crime. Each case is unique, and the defense strategy is tailored to the specific circumstances surrounding the allegations.
